Should You Buy a 2014 Cadillac ELR?

The 2014 Cadillac ELR is a luxury coupe that combines electric efficiency with a refined driving experience. With a front-wheel drive layout and a 1.4L I4 engine, it delivers 149 horsepower and a robust 273 lb-ft of torque, making it suitable for both city driving and highway cruising. The ELR boasts a combined fuel economy of 33 MPG, appealing to eco-conscious buyers looking for a stylish vehicle without sacrificing performance. Its MSRP of $75,000 positions it within the luxury segment, attracting those who appreciate premium features and cutting-edge technology.

This vehicle is designed for those who value a sophisticated aesthetic and innovative engineering. The interior is well-appointed, offering seating for four and a range of high-end features. While it may not be the most powerful option in its class, the ELR's unique blend of electric power and luxury makes it a compelling choice for buyers seeking an upscale, environmentally friendly coupe.
